Amid the escalated effects of the monsoons in Goa, waterlogging has severely affected the tunnels between Karmali and Thivim railway stations. Due to this, the Konkan Railway authorities have decided to divert five trains or tranship passengers of four other trains that run on this route. Here's the index of diverted trains-

As per the information given by Konkan Railway Goa PRO Baban Ghatge, the following 5 trains have been diverted

  • Train no. 2618 H. Nizamuddin Ernakulam Express will pass through Panvel, Karjat, Pune Jn, Miraj Jn, Hubballi, Krishnarajapuram, Erode Jn, Shoranur Jn as a part of the new route assigned to it.
  • Train No. 04696 Amritsar Jn - Kochuveli Weekly Special dated July 18, will take a diverted path running through Panvel, Karjat, Pune Jn, Miraj Jn, Hubballi, Krishnarajapuram, Erode Jn, Shoranur Jn and further connected route.
  • Train No. 01224 Ernakulam Jn - Lokmanya Tilak (T) Duranto bi-weekly special dated July 18 will take an alternate route passing through Madgaon Jn, Londa Jn, Miraj Jn, Pune Jn, Karjat, Panvel and further proper route.
  • Train No. 09261 Kochuveli - Porbandar weekly special dated July 18 has been diverted via Madgaon Jn, Londa Jn, Miraj Jn, Pune Jn, Karjat, Panvel and further proper route.
  • Train No. 02977 Ernakulam Jn - Ajmer Jn Weekly Special dated July 18 has been diverted via Madgaon Jn, Londa Jn, Miraj Jn, Pune Jn, Karjat, Panvel and further proper route.

Passengers from THESE trains are being diverted

  • Passengers of Train No. 01111 Mumbai CST - Madgaon Jn 'Konkankanya' Daily Special dated July 18 are being transhipped from Thivim to Madgaon Jn railway stations.
  • Passengers from Train No. 01114 Madgaon Jn - Mumbai CST 'Mandovi' Daily Special dated July 19, which originated from Thivim railway station at 12:00 hrs on July 19 are also being transhipped. They will move from Margao to Thivim railway stations.
  • Passengers who have reservations in Train No. 02432 H. Nizamuddin - Thiruvananthapuram Central 'Rajdhani' tri-weekly special dated July 18 are being transhipped from Pernem railway station to Madgaon junction.
  • Passengers with booked tickets for Train No. 02413 Madgaon Jn - H. Nizamuddin 'Rajdhani' bi-weekly special dated July 19 are being transhipped from Madgaon Jn to Pernem railway station.


Additionally, the PRO informed that interventions have already been initiated to clear the tracks.
